Leighton Holdings Ltd - Qtr4, Fourth Quarter Update 08/09
Leighton Asia has been operating at the MSJ coal mine in East Kalimantan since 2004, when it signed an initial three year contract. Leighton Asia was also responsible for constructing an 8.5 kilometre haul road from the mine site to the port area under a separate contract. Leighton Asia is responsible for the open cut mining of coal at the MSJ coal mine. The scope of work includes the removal of overburden, the loading and transportation of coal from the mine site to the port, and maintenance of the mine's haul road. The scope of work has been increased since August 2007, requiring Leighton to produce almost eight million tonnes of coal over a three-year period. The extension will require two additional truck and shovel fleets and associated support equipment.
